While Higher Education institutions aim students to develop the concept of academic integrity (AI1), the arrival of artificial intelligence tools (AI2) like ChatGPT puts the process of teaching-learning to test. Respective to teachers, they must inculcate ethical values while students are confronted with a great deal of factors that influence them during their academic writings. Given this situation, the main objective of this article is to determine the competencies that must be developed in this era of continued immersion in AI2 to guarantee AI1. To do so, the results of a quantitative descriptive analysis of the relevant sections and questions from questionnaires of the faculty (1357 participants) and the students (4664 participants) who participated in this first data collection of the study by Partnership on University Plagiarism Prevention (PUPP), conducted in 2023, will be used to apply them to the discipline of Spanish as a foreign language (SFL). The conclusion will be that, to accomplish their respective tasks, it is necessary that faculty and students work hand in hand.
